Murray Cook has a long track record of consistent success in building companies and developing executive teams in complex markets and emerging technology environments.  As an innovative strategic leader and skilled communicator, he displays a comprehensive understanding of business and customer needs from product conceptualization through development, deployment, customer delivery and after-sales support. 

In addition to being a successful technology architect – particularly in Enterprise Reverse Supply Chain Management – Murray is adept at financial model architecture for multi-year company, business unit, program and product development, and was the functional architect for an online brokerage and financial management company.  With the DOD, he managed development of critical communications programs, and acted as strategy/business/financial consultant aligned with sensitive DOD programs and related industries.

He has extensive domestic and international sales management experience in both Global 500 and startup companies. His industry experience spans Government (DOD, Intelligence, Security), Energy, Financial Services, Insurance, Technology and Consumer Electronics industries.  Murray's accomplishments include development of sales organizations from initialization to $200M+ recurring revenue, as well as development of direct and channel sales programs (OEM, VAR, Distributor, Integrator, Retail).  Further, he has been a key manager and advisor on mergers and acquisitions for technology and DOD companies.  

As President of Brown and Cook Consulting, Inc., he provides management consulting focused on emerging software architecture, communication and messaging innovations, strategic repositioning of Global 500 divisions.  Mr. Brown also acts as an advisor to startup CEOs and Division General Managers for development of corporate strategy, product development, market positioning/repositioning, sales strategy, capital acquisition; Liaison between investment capital sources and company executives; and financial advisor on investment structure.

From 2001 to 2006, Murray was CEO of eBoomerang, Inc., during which time he provided turnaround leadership for Venture Capital investment, and was the chief functional architect for innovative business intelligence intelligence in Supply Chain/Reverse Supply Chain.  He formed a joint development effort with a Fortune 500 company for comprehensive product development, secured marquis customers, developed market positioning and messaging strategy, and recruited and retained technical and executive team as well as senior executive board of directors.  During this time he established the company as "Best of Breed" technology in the Reverse supply Chain industry, and secured a merger partnership with an Enterprise Supply Chain Software company.

As CEO of Migration Software Systems Ltd. from 1989 to 2001, Murray identified an emerging market opportunity and founded a consulting company driven by innovative RISC technology change in the computer industry.  He designed and developed early core systems and technologies, secured major contracts with Fortune 500 companies (Cisco, GE, HP, DEC, BEA) and Government agencies (DOD, Intelligence Community) for system development, and developed the company's financial/reinvestment model.  Mr. Brown recruited, mentored and retained executive team and senior technical staff, established their international consulting business with operations in the UK and France, and built multiple market penetration while maintaining profitability.  In addition, he provided executive consulting services to startup companies, government agencies, and Global 500 companies for technology selection and implementation as well as innovative sales channel development.

Prior to Migration Software Systems, Murray also held key positions at MIPS Computer Systems, (1987-1989), Stanford Telecommunications (1985-1987), Parallel Computer Systemm (1983-1985) and Digital Equipment Corporation (1972-1983)

Murray has served on the Board of Directors for Foliofn, Inc., and Migration Software, LLC, as well the Board of Advisors for Mantech International (NASDAQ: MANT), Azora Techologies, and Aegis Research Corporation.

Murray earned a B.S. in Mathematics from the University of Florida and an M.S. in Electrical Engineering with a specialization in Biomedical Engineering, from the University of Santa Clara. He is a graduate of the Tuck Executive Management Program through the Tuck School of Business at Dartmouth College. He is also a graduate of the Air Force Institute of Technology, with a graduate residency at Texas A and M University, in Meteorology, and he is a Certified Meteorologist.
